Since we are medievalists, I would refer also to:
Petrus Lombardus, Sententiae IV 28, 3 n. 2: Dicamus igitur quod
consensus cohabitationis vel carnalis copulae non facit coniugium, sed
consensus coniugalis societatis, verbis secundum praesens tempus
expressus, ut cum vir dicit: Ego accipio te in meam, non dominam, non
ancillam, sed coniugem.
See also Decretum Gratiani (Concordia discordantium canonum)pars : 2,
causa : 27, quaest. : 2, canon : 2, dictum post, pag. : 1063, linea :
18
